MeT forecasts rain, snow in J&K; Dry weather expected from March 5

SRINAGAR (KIMS) — The Meteorological Department on Sunday predicted light to moderate rain and snowfall at isolated places across Jammu and Kashmir over the next 24 hours.

Some areas, particularly in higher altitudes, may experience intermittent snowfall, while the plains could receive light rainfall.

According to the data, widespread light to moderate rain and snow are expected in parts of Jammu and Kashmir over the next two days. However, the precipitation is likely to be scattered, affecting some areas rather than the entire Union Territory.

From March 5, weather conditions are expected to improve, with predominantly dry weather prevailing across Jammu and Kashmir until March 8.

Meanwhile, Srinagar recorded 2.3°C, Kupwara -1.2°C, Gulmarg -7.5°C, Pahalgam -4.7°C and Kokernag 0.4°C as the minimum temperature in Kashmir division on Sunday.

In Jammu Division, Jammu recorded 9.8°C, Katra 11.2°C, Batote 5.2°C, Banihal 3.3°C and Bhaderwah 2.9°C as the minimum temperature. — (KIMS)
